| Title |
Establishment and characterization of a murine astroglial cell line. |

| Abstract |
A murine cell line, designated as KT-5, was established from a brain tumor
induced by the interplacental injection of N-nitrosomethyl urea. KT-5
cells grew in vitro with a doubling time of 17h. The karyotype of KT-5
cells was pseudotriploid with a modal chromosome number of 61. KT-5 was
tumorigenic when transplanted ether intraperitoneally or subcutaneously
into C3H/He mouse. Immunocytochemical analysis demonstrated that KT-5 was
immunopositive for glial fibrillary acidic protein (GFAP) and S100 protein
but not for Thy-1, myelin basic protein, or neurofilament, suggesting that
KT-5 cell derives from a murine astrocyte. Conditioned medium of KT-5
contained neurite-promoting activity for neurons and growth-promoting
activity for KT-5 cells themselves.
